cCrosswinds and rough roads adversely
affect vehicle/trailer handling, possibly
causing vehicle sway. When being
passed by larger vehicles, be prepared
for possible changes in crosswinds that
could affect vehicle handling. If swaying
does occur, firmly grip the steering
wheel, steer straight ahead, and imme-
diately (but gradually) reduce vehicle
speed. This combination helps to stabi-
lize the vehicle. Never increase speed.
cBe careful when passing other vehicles.
Passing while towing a trailer requires
considerably more distance than normal
passing. Remember the length of the
trailer must also pass the other vehicle
before you can safely change lanes.
cTo maintain engine braking efficiency
and electrical charging performance, do
not use fifth gear (manual transmission)
or overdrive (automatic transmission).
cAvoid holding the brake pedal down too
long or too frequently. This could cause
the brakes to overheat, resulting in re-
duced braking efficiency.
When towing a trailer, change the oil in
the transmission more frequently. For
additional information see the ``Mainte-
nance'' section earlier in this manual.DOT Quality Grades: All passenger car tires
must conform to Federal Safety Require-
ments in addition to these grades.
Quality grades can be found where appli-
cable on the tire sidewall between tread
shoulder and maximum section width. For
example:
Treadwear 200 Traction AA Temperature A
Treadwear
Treadwear grade is a comparative rating
based on tire wear rate when tested under
controlled conditions on specified govern-
ment test courses. For example, a tire
graded 150 would wear one and a half
(1-1/2) times as well on the government
course as a tire graded 100. However,
relative tire performance depends on actual
driving conditions, and may vary signifi-
cantly due to variations in driving habits,
service practices and differences in road
characteristics and climate.
Traction AA, A, B and C
The traction grades, from highest to lowest,
are AA, A, B, and C. Those grades repre-
sent a tire's ability to stop on wet pavement
as measured under controlled conditions,
on specified government test surfaces of
asphalt and concrete. A tire marked C may
have poor traction performance.
WARNING
The traction grade assigned to your
vehicle tires is based on straight-ahead
braking traction tests, and does notin-
clude acceleration cornering, hydro-
planing, or peak traction characteris-
tics.
Temperature A, B and C
Temperature grades are A (the highest), B,
and C. They represent a tire's resistance to
heat build-up, and its ability to dissipate
heat when tested under controlled condi-
tions on a specified indoor laboratory test
wheel. Sustained high temperature can
cause tire material to degenerate, reducing
tire life. Excessive temperatures can lead to
sudden tire failure. Grade C corresponds to
a performance level which all passenger car
tires must meet under the Federal Motor
Vehicle Safety Standard No. 109. Grades A
and B represent higher levels of perfor-
mance on laboratory test wheels than the
minimum required by law.
